This week, we’re talking about your personal brand – what it is, how to build a personal brand, and why it’s so important in today’s hyper-connected information age. We dig into how much of your personal and professional selves should blend and the work you need to do behind-the-scenes to ensure the brand you’re portraying authentically represents who you are. ‘Fake it ‘til you make it’ is not the same as being fake. At the end of the day, we may not be able to control our narrative, but we can shape it. And if you don’t shape your brand story, others will shape it for you.
